Output 3ba6f6113bba247ab0ce29dd3966e3f4e13881bf50a77171eb866352d084487b:0

value
54551512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32dc5391c547c58a5ad60aea8f5490703f57cedd OP_EQUAL
address
MCY5xa6GUipc4ncrct6FYNTC9NZkNtehfq
transaction
3ba6f6113bba247ab0ce29dd3966e3f4e13881bf50a77171eb866352d084487b
spent
true